ARAB 3001 - Advanced Arabic I

Institution:
Pennsylvania Western University
Subject:
Arabic
Description:
Advanced Arabic I is the continuation of Intermediate Arabic II. In this course, students will acquire a genuine command of the Arabic language by listening, speaking, reading, writing, and the ability to understand the culture . There is intense practice in conversation, composition, phonetics, and culture.
